Defining the dial-in ISDN participant in MCU B and Dial-out ISDN
participant in MCU A (for MCU-to-MCU cascading conferences).
A dial out ISDN participant is defined (added) to conference A. The
participant's dial out number is the dial-in number of the Entry
Queue or conference running on MCU B (for example 54145106).
MCU A dials out to an Entry Queue or conference B running on MCU
B using the Entry Queue number (for example 54145106) or the
conference number.
